FERRANDI Paris accelerates international development (France)

FERRANDI Paris announces that it has signed four new academic partnerships with foreign institutions: the Institute for Tourism Studies in Macau, Johnson and Wales University in the United States, CETT at Barcelona University and ITHQ in Montreal.

As of September 2019, these agreements will enable students in the 2nd and 3rd year of the Bachelor's degree in Hotel and Restaurant management to complete a semester with these partner universities, after which they will be able to continue their stay by interning for 6 months. FERRANDI Paris is the only school in its field to offer two Bachelors approved by the French Ministry of Higher Education, Research and Innovation, an asset for better international recognition.

Strengthening academic partnerships

These agreements reinforce the programs’ international dimension, already implemented in the Master of Science Hotel Management offered by FERRANDI Paris. Thanks to an agreement with The Kong-Kong Polytechnic University, one of Asia's leading educational institutions in the sector, MSc students will embark on a one-month study trip to Hong Kong, during which they will focus on innovation in hospitality.

Courses offered 100% in English

Another novelty for the start of September 2019: students in their third year of hotel management and catering will have the choice to continue the course either in French or in English. Those who read the Master of Science Hotel Management course will be able to opt for either a bilingual track (French and English) or one exclusively in English.

Courses specially designed for foreign students

Furthermore, FERRANDI Paris is launching two Advanced Professional Programs, in “French Cuisine" and “French Pastry" respectively, which complete its portfolio of courses for foreign students (Training Weeks, tailor-made courses and Intensive Programs). These Advanced Professional Programs, that last 8 weeks, will be offered to professionals wishing to upgrade their skills and will taught by prestigious experts, such as MOF, world champions, Michelin starred chefs etc. The school welcomes 300 students of over 30 different nationalities every year on its Paris campus, with students mainly from China, Taiwan, the United States, Brazil, Canada, India and Korea.

About FERRANDI Paris:

Founded in 1920 by the CCI Paris Ile-de-France, FERRANDI Paris offers a wide range of programs, from vocational training to Master degrees, preparing its students for careers in the culinary and hotel management fields. FERRANDI Paris trains young people, professionals and career-switchers, from France and abroad, on 4 sites : Paris, Jouy-en-Josas, Saint Gratien and Bordeaux (through an alliance with Bordeaux Ecole Supérieure de la Table, CCI de Bordeaux-Gironde).
